What to Expect from Your Pamukkale Paragliding Flight
Okay, so before I actually took off, I, very nearly, had this idea of what the flight could be. But nothing really matched the real deal. Basically, it starts with meeting the crew, getting ready with all the safety bits. Then, you have this brief that fills you in on what to expect and how to position your body during the key points. What is genuinely awesome, in a way, is seeing how experienced the pilots seemed. Their confidence really did help calm those “butterflies” you might feel.
The take-off really felt quick. Basically, it’s just a few steps, and then, bam, you are airborne! Now, that view… pictures just don’t capture it properly. The white terraces spread out below, Hierapolis off in the distance – the ancient city almost seems to come back to life from up there. I was so glad that I could take photos. Though I had a camera phone holder just to make sure that my camera didn’t end up thousands of feet below!
During the flight, which typically is about 20-30 minutes, you might feel different emotions. At first, I was a bit nervous, obviously, but soon, I just relaxed, in some respects, and took in the calmness and that amazing scene. The pilot probably will guide you. They may even point out a few hotspots or, sometimes, even let you steer a bit if that’s what you are into. That said, how gentle or wild your trip is might come down to weather and the pilot’s style. Don’t wait. This adventure awaits.

Safety First: What About Safe Paragliding?
Right, safety can be quite the big deal when you are thinking about paragliding, obviously. I was also curious before signing up. Seeing how well-prepared the company was made all the difference.
Before anything else, so the pilots take their gear seriously, just a little. From what I could tell, these guys check everything regularly – the lines, the canopy, even their harnesses. That sort of gave me some reassurance, right? They really make sure they go with current safety guidelines. Basically, this involves following weather updates super carefully and adjusting flight schedules depending on the conditions, of course.
Then, so they make you go through detailed pre-flight checks. It’s more than just signing papers. It is also hearing and understanding the landing strategies and any possible “what-ifs.” They made sure I got comfortable with the equipment. Plus, getting to hear that their pilots have solid certifications and experience was also comforting. Actually, checking ahead to make sure an outfit ticks these safety boxes may be really helpful if you have your sight set on your own trip.
Choosing the Right Paragliding Company
Okay, figuring out which paragliding company is good really makes that difference in your Pamukkale adventure. A good place makes everything run smoother. Finding one doesn’t have to be hard though.
So, checking reviews could be something to do. What people say about safety, staff experience, or how good the equipment feels helps, too it’s almost like crowd-sourcing your decision. Don’t just go for the cost; compare what is included, like pick-up service, pictures, and such.
The certifications and any affiliations they got with aviation groups are solid, and it is something you can ask them, right? Ask about pilot background – what training do they get? How often do they maintain stuff? And when you contact them, do they actually give complete replies that show real professionalism?
When you meet them before heading up, notice that. Did that safety run-through feel really thorough? Are the people helpful? Making a short list and investigating might mean finding the very best company. It could also result in experiences you treasure versus ones where things just felt “okay.”
Tips for an Unforgettable Flight
Okay, so you wanna make your paragliding over Pamukkale something actually memorable? Here’s what I found out. Firstly, so schedule that flight during morning hours or toward late afternoon, right before sunset, for some awesome light.
Layers really become a good thing, depending on what season you’re heading over. Comfy footwear? Huge win! Chat with your pilot beforehand. Tell him how chilled you hope to be, ask them where is interesting down below, things that actually customize it.
If it’s alright, get the picture bundle the agency offers. Having skilled photos definitely means remembering your bird’s-view trip, you know? Do consider getting a camera mount and ensure it has security straps. Lastly? Stay open to anything.
